Cerebral palsy is an incurable motor impairment that affects balance and posture, muscle tone and coordination. It is usually caused by injuries to the unborn brain or the infant's brain prior to or after childbirth. If a physician causes this type of injury, they could be held accountable and families could be able to recover compensation for medical expenses, lost income as well as other losses arising from a cerebral palsy lawsuit if negligence is proved.

Ask about the track record of cerebral palsy attorneys and how many cases they have dealt with similar to yours. The right lawyer can help you access the funds needed to provide the lifetime of care, treatments and assistive technology for your family member with CP.

The amount of compensation granted for cerebral palsy cases can vary from state to, and is often determined by whether the person who suffered was seeking non-economic damages or damages. Economic damages could include medical expenses treatments, therapy education, as well as loss of income. Non-economic damages can include emotional trauma, pain and suffering, as well as a lower quality of life.

A lawyer for cerebral palsy will review your case to determine if medical negligence occurred during labor and delivery that could have caused the condition of your child. They will then take action on your behalf, if they believe there was medical negligence involved. Your lawyer will handle all aspects of your claim so that you can focus on the health of your child.

Cerebral palsy (CP) is a type of neurological disorders that affect motor control. It is caused by either abnormal development of the brain or damage that occurs during the birth or pregnancy. A cerebral palsy lawyer with the right qualifications can assist families in obtaining compensation for medical expenses that are related to CP.

It is important to hire an attorney for cerebral palsy as soon as you realize medical negligence. There are laws, known as statutes of limitation, which restrict the time that you have to pursue legal action after an injury. Selecting a seasoned lawyer will ensure you can file your lawsuit within the prescribed timeframe.

During your free consultation, talk to the attorney about their experience handling birth injury medical malpractice cases. Also, inquire about their reputation, and if they have any accreditation of their expertise in their field or peer-reviewed acknowledgement from an associate.

A experienced attorney for birth injuries will examine your case in detail and gather evidence. They may make use of expert testimony or witness interviews to construct a convincing case against the medical professionals who defended you. This evidence can aid them in determining the precise cause of your child’s cerebral palsy and also build an effective case for financial compensation. These cases are settled without going to court in the majority of instances. If a trial is necessary attorneys will prepare for it.
